当前位置: 首页 > 软件库 > 程序开发 > 游戏开发包 >

J2me 游戏脚本引擎

授权协议 未知
开发语言 Java
所属分类 程序开发、 游戏开发包
软件类型 开源软件
地区 不详
投 递 者 苏嘉歆
操作系统 J2ME
开源组织
适用人群 未知
 软件概览

一个非常小的script脚本引擎,可以同时在j2me / j2se / c++ platform上面运行

它的目标是使用这个脚本引擎便于开发一个更加灵活的j2me 游戏这个脚本有点像BASIC这东西不错,是一个开源的脚本引擎,大家可以学习里面的思想里面其中带了一个例子,是3子棋。感觉挺不错的。这东西在SF也挺活跃的。

  • 原文 http://www.3geye.net/?3/viewspace-3187 昨天,因为工作需要想了解下脚步引擎的实现原理,下载了一个 开源的 脚本引擎,研究了下, 3GEYE^9ys.p�^.p;G!s 如果大家需要下载的,请到我空间Google下,就可以发现这个脚本引擎的具体地址。 3GEYEX6xWl(p Y!Cl)z1^$` 下面我来说下这个脚本引擎的一些 性能问题。 ![n t*w

  • 游戏引擎在国内还是有一批人走在前沿的,但出于种种的原因发展的并不是很好,并且引擎的神秘面纱和不可揣测的高难度使一些人还没有正式开始就已经打了退堂鼓。通常我们说游戏引擎的时候总是想到3D游戏引擎,的确游戏引擎发展到今天将它发挥到极致的正是3D引擎,但在3D引擎之前其实还是有很多2D,2.5D游戏引擎的,它们现在虽然看起来很弱,但却为3D引擎的产生提供了巨大的理论支持。   原理上讲引擎的结构真的很简

  • 文章来源:J2ME开发网 前言       有几点需要说明一下,本人也是出于工作需要才开始的游戏引擎的开发,本文更多的是心得与引擎理论的一些讲述,后面有一些小小的效果技巧和工程组织方面的文字,代码也是有一点的(呵呵,叫大家失望了),代码也基本上也是从细胞分裂和古墓丽影中摘抄出的。相信对大家有帮助。 本人第一次比较象回事的写文章。我其实很懒的,但从开始学习游戏到第一个游戏完成,j2me开发网给了我许

  • 为什么要使用J2ME来读取INI(配置)文件呢?在单机版游戏当中,使用INI文件来读取相关命令实属多余,但是在编写网络游戏时,由客户端读取从服务器传来的INI文件流就显得相当重要了。因为 手机游戏客户端是写死的程序,不可能实现像PC网络游戏那样进行下载客户端的升级。 因此,将一些经常需要改动的游戏元素,如:NPC属性,地图属性等保存到服务器端,在改动的时候只需要简单地改变服务器端保存的INI文件内

  •  非游戏方面: 1 熟练掌握Java语言语义语法和J2ME 2 写命令行工具,要精通J2SE的部分API,尤其是IO操作方面,或精通C++的相关内容,或Python等 3 写编辑器,要能熟练掌握 Swing, MFC, VB, Delphi...等其中之一 5 能熟练使用操作系统批处理命令,进行项目编译等 或 掌握ant 6 数据结构和算法,至少能分析问题找出合适的结构和算法,然后翻书。这方面多研

  • 为什么要使用J2ME 来读取INI (配置)文件呢?在单机版游戏当中,使用INI 文件来读取相关命令实属多余,但是在编写网络游戏时,由客户端读取从服务器传来的INI 文件流就显得相当重要了。因为手机游戏客户端是写死的程序,不可能实现像PC 网络游戏那样进行下载客户端的升级。 因此,将一些经常需要改动的游戏元素,如:NPC 属性,地图属性等保存到服务器端,在改动的时候只需要简单地改变服务器端保存的I

 相关资料
  • 本文向大家介绍点球小游戏python脚本,包括了点球小游戏python脚本的使用技巧和注意事项,需要的朋友参考一下 本文实例为大家分享了python点球小游戏的具体代码,供大家参考,具体内容如下 1.游戏要求: 设置球的方向:左中右三个方向,射门或者扑救动作,循环5次,直接输入方向。电脑随机挑选方向,如果方向相同,那么电脑得分,如果方向相反,那么人得分。 2.分析如何写程序: 1)循环,使用for

  • 问题内容: 我最近一直在研究游戏开发,而我的第一种编程语言是Java。在玩了许多用c ++开发的令人惊叹的游戏之后,我想知道为什么Java在游戏行业中没有被大量使用。我查看了jMonkeyEngine 3和其他一些游戏引擎环境,但是看到的屏幕截图远没有那么令人惊叹。诸如EA的《极品飞车》(Need for Speed Hot)和ubisoft的Assassins Creed等标题传达了这种现实感。

  • 本文向大家介绍微信跳一跳游戏python脚本,包括了微信跳一跳游戏python脚本的使用技巧和注意事项,需要的朋友参考一下 微信更新后出来了一块比较火的小游戏,要是一款不涉及到排行的游戏,可能 没人去关注这款游戏。最开自己一直苦练技术,想在微信排行上面装一装,练了好久才跑三百多分。接着在Github(Github地址),有一个大神发布了,一个Python脚本自动跳,分数随便跳,当然分数不要太高,分

  • 12.19 技术一面 12.22 技术二面 12.26 三面(主管+hr) 1.5 交叉面 1.8 oc 其实很想每次把面经给记录下来,但实在怕有潜在竞争对手,这个广州只剩1个hc的岗位对我来说真的很重要 之前灵犀11月底发过冬季补录的邮件,但我写了之后没什么回应,转机竟然是实验室同门在boxx上被灵犀的人联系,然后转推了我,大半个月走完了流程;虽然在深圳这边只实习了一个月,但还是学到了很多东西,

  • 创建和销毁游戏对象 某些游戏在场景中维护恒定数量的对象,但是在游戏过程中,创建和移除人物、物品以及其他对象也非常普遍。在 Unity 中,一个游戏对象可以通过 Instantiate 函数创建一个已有对象的新副本。 public GameObject enemy; void Start() { for (int i = 0; i < 5; i++) { Instantiat

  • 使用组件控制游戏对象 在 Unity 编辑器中,你可以使用检视视图修改组件的属性。例如,改变游戏对象的变换组件的位置值,将会导致游戏对象的位置发生变化。类似地,修改渲染器材质的颜色或刚体的质量,将会对象的外观或行为产生相应的影响。大多数情况下,脚本也可以修改组件属性,从而操纵游戏对象。不同的是,脚本可以随时间改变属性的值,或响应用户的输入。通过在正确的时间修改、创建和销毁对象,可以实现任何类型的游